Missing a file

Hey so i decided to play dragon age origins and dragon age 2 again, problem is i want to use the dev console in dragon age 2, in dragon age origins i could do this without any problems, but in dragon age 2 the first method does not work and by this i mean creating a shortcut properties then typing in enabledeveloperconsole, so the next method was to edit the launcher.xml but here is the major problem the file is not there.....i bought the game not not 2 hours ago downloaded installed went to the files dragon age data and the only file that is there is dragonage2config why isn't my launcher.xml file there? how do i get this file can someone give me answers please?

4 Replies

  • Yeah, they changed it in the August update to the Origin client, but you can still get there.

    1.  From the Origin "My Games" screen, right-click on DA2 and choose "Game Properties".

    2. In the "Command line arguments" textbox, put "-enabledeveloperconsole" (without the quotation marks, of course.) 😕mileywink:

    (They also borked using the DragonAge2Launcher completely, but that's another matter...)
